Irish trainer Pat Shanahan is out to secure further success at Musselburgh on Sunday after the Irish trainer saddled his first course winner at the East Lothian track's historic Good Friday card.
Formerly a leading Flat jockey, Shanahan is represented by four runners, all partnered by his compatriot Tadhg O'Shea.
First up is Maid Of The Glens in the Best Odds At totepool.com Maiden Stakes while Dancing Cosmos shoulders top-weight in the Win Big With Totejackpot Handicap.
Shanahan said: "Dancing Cosmos has plenty of winning form on the all-weather but she is still a maiden on turf. She could go well but she has plenty of weight and we could do with a drop of rain."
The Shanahan stable is also represented in the £20,000 feature, the Totepool Musselburgh Gold Cup, by King Of The Picts.
He added: "This horse ran a great race when third behind Josses Hill in a Grade Two at Aintree. It will be his first run on the Flat for a couple of years and he is another that is better suited by easier ground."
Among the nine rivals facing King Of The Picts is Bright Abbey, ridden by Graham Lee, and Entihaa, who was a promising third on his comeback on soft ground at Newcastle last month.
Shanahan's final runner is Tiffany Bay who makes her handicap debut in the Download The Totepool Live Info App Handicap.
